Just seen <https://stackoverflow.com/a/12662703> which indicates that
as of
C++11, you can use a const_iterator for a call to erase (since the
modifiability
is ensured by the object erase is called on and the const-ness of the
iterator
is irrelevant) but apparently not previously. So I guess it is my
newer
compiler that made the erase call work without complaint. I'll see
how I can
make this C++08(?)-save.
